"Warren will provide an update on the current state of the United Inventors Association, including the new management team, with particular emphasis on recent UIA efforts to derail the so called Washington "Patent Troll" legislation, a Bill working through Congress that would have had dramatic negative consequences for independent inventors. This Bill was sponsored by several silicon valley high tech firms, including Google, and was just tabled in May by Senator Patrick Leahy Chairman of the Senate Judiciary Committee. Our own CT Senator Blumenthal sits on the Judiciary Committee as well."
Warren Tuttle is the founder and CEO of Monashee
Marketing based in New Canaan, CT. and the current
President of the United Inventors Association. He
positions himself as the “Housewares Guru” having been
associated with the industry for many years. He was the
person behind the scenes helping orchestrate the
introduction and success of Smart Spin. With almost 10
million units sold to date, Smart Spin continues to be
prominently featured at major retailers throughout
America.
Warren also helped to initiate the market launch of
several other innovative kitchen products including MISTO,
The Gourmet Olive Oil Sprayer as well as The Toss and Turn
Pan, one of the best selling cookware fry pans in the US
in 2005. Warren has also assisted numerous housewares
product patent holders to obtain licensing agreements with
major U.S. manufacturers and counseled several inventors
who went on to start their own small businesses.
Additionally, Warren leads the external product
development program at Lifetime Brands of Garden City, New
York, the world’s largest manufacturer of kitchen utensils
and a major supplier of food prep and table top products
to all of America’s major retailers. To date, Warren has
initiated several major new product launchings with
Lifetime Brands, including The Speed Prep Mandolin, The
Odor Absorbing Splatter Screen and The Bagel Pod.
